Часто задаваемые вопросы
Почему ранее замьюченный участник всё равно не может писать даже после окончания мьюта?
Скорее всего вы используете мьюты по ролям. Иногда список ролей не обновляется своевременно на стороне приложения Discord и оно считает, что роль всё ещё есть и продолжает накладывать ограничения.
Такое особенно часто происходит в условиях нестабильного соединения с интернетом.
Повторное снятие мьюта командой принудительно заставляет клиент дискорда обновить данные о его ролях. Это аналогично, если бы участник полностью перезапустил приложение Discord, он смог бы снова писать.
Рекомендация
Мы настоятельно рекомендуем использовать мьют в режиме только по таймаутам, чтобы полностью избежать этой проблемы.
Бот не отправляет приветственное сообщение.
У данной проблемы может быть несколько причин:
- Вы проверяете это на боте. JuniperBot не пишет приветственное сообщение ботам;
- На сервере включен "Отбор участников" (Membership Screening) и участник не согласился с правилами Вашего сервера.
Бот не выдаёт начальные роли или не восстанавливает роли перезашедшим участникам.
У данной проблемы может быть несколько причин:
- Вы проверяете это на боте. JuniperBot не выдаёт начальные/восстанавливаемые роли ботам;
- У бота нет прав на изменение ролей участников;
- Проблемные роли выше роли бота, из-за чего бот не может выдать их согласно иерархии;
- Проблемная роль назначена как роль мьюта в настройках модерации (роль мьюта в начальных/восстанавливаемых игнорируется, бот выдаёт её независимо только если участник был замьючен и мьют ещё в силе);
- На сервере включен "Отбор участников" (Membership Screening) и участник не согласился с правилами Вашего сервера;
- Для восстановления ролей у бота должна быть возможность запомнить имеющиеся роли участника в момент его выхода; Роли участника в момент выхода с сервера известны боту только в случае, если участник был в сети (не оффлайн и не невидимка) и недавно проявлял на сервере какую-либо активность.
Заикается/отключается музыка или радио. Что делать?
У данной проблемы может быть несколько причин:
- Высокая нагруженность музыкального сервера: Степень нагрузки отображается в панели воспроизведения в самом дискорде и на странице Статистики. Если нагрузка менее 80%, проблема не в этом.
- Проблемы с соединением до голосового шлюза Discord или его высокая нагруженность: Между Вами и ботом есть узел, называемый голосовым шлюзом. У Discord их несколько и каждый привязан к выбранному в настройках голосового канала Региону. Проблемы могут быть как между шлюзом и ботом, так и между Вами и этим шлюзом. Пробуйте менять регион голосового канала и смотреть будут ли улучшения на каком-нибудь из них (полностью перезапуская при этом воспроизведение музыки).
- Проблемы с соединением бота до источника музыки: По независимым от нас причинам имеют место быть проблемы с соединением до источника музыки когда сам источник музыки тормозит или нестабильное соединение до него. Проблема может нести как временный, так и постоянный характер и преимущественно для радиостанций. К сожалению, мы не компания с огромным бюджетом и не можем иметь по музыкальному серверу в каждой точке мира, чтобы обеспечивать стабильное соединение ко всему что только возможно.
Какие разрешения необходимы для доступа к панели управления ботом?
Доступ к панели управления ботом могут получить только владелец сервера и администраторы (пользователи, у которых есть роль с правом "Администратор").
Внимание
Будьте внимательны, так как участник с этими правами способен изменить любой параметр в панели управления. Он сможет даже получить роли выше собственных при желании.
Что за печеньки в рангах, профиле участника, странице рейтинга?
Просто счетчик, карма, система репутации. Чтобы повысить этот счетчик, можно:
- Написать сообщение с обращением к участнику и эмоцией печеньки 🍪, например:
@JuniperBot :cookie: - Добавить реакцию 🍪 к сообщению этого участника.
Информация
Один участник другому может дать 🍪 только раз в 10 минут.
Что такое кластер и звено?
Звено — часть JuniperBot, которая отвечает за обработку определённого набора серверов. Кластер — физический сервер, который отвечает за обработку определённых звеньев.
Можно ли воспроизвести сохраненный ранее плейлист бота и как это сделать?
Для поддержавших есть такая возможность, можно просто передать ссылку на плейлист командой !плей:
!плей https://juniper.bot/playlist/99eb328f-d970-4265-ae6f-07c1d7ac8682
Ссылки на плейлист всегда отображаются в сообщениях о воспроизведении после нажатия кнопки сохранения плейлиста.
Будет ли функционал экономики?
Не будет. Совсем. Никак. Никогда. Используйте наш шаблонный движок, и сделайте нужный вам функционал сами.
Будет ли поддержка плейлистов и музыки ВКонтакте?
Нет. Скажите спасибо жадным копирастам, из-за которых ВКонтакте закрыл публичный доступ к инструментарию музыки.
Как рассчитать количество опыта на тот или иной уровень?
Изучите статью Начисление опыта.
Как настроить экспорт постов из группы ВКонтакте, уведомления о новых видео от YouTube каналов или оповещение о начале трансляции на Twitch?
В панели управления вашим сервером в разделе "Публикации и подписки" нажмите на плюсик в правом нижнем углу, выберите интересующую Вас платформу и следуйте дальнейшим инструкциям.
Как ограничить использование команды по роли или в каналах?
Изучите статью Пользовательские команды. Настройки прав доступа применимы и для встроенных команд.
Информационные сообщения о мьюте/бане/кике/преде участника удаляются через некоторое время. Как это отключить?
В панели управления в разделе "Общие" в настройках сообщений есть опция "Удалять сообщения об успешных операциях". Введите туда 0 если хотите, чтобы эти сообщения не удалялись.
На каком языке программирования написан бот?
Бот написан на Kotlin и Java.
У меня есть идея. Где я могу её предложить?
Вы можете предложить свою идею на нашем фидбэке.